Prime Minister Narendra Modi on Saturday interacted with world leaders, including US President Joe Biden, on the sidelines of the G20 Summit and exchanged pleasantries.
In a series of photos tweeted by the PMO India, Prime Minister Modi is seen meeting Joe Biden, French President Emmanuel Macron, UK Prime Minister Boris Johnson and Canadian Prime Minister Justin Trudeau.
PM Modi is seen walking with Joe Biden, apparently sharing a light chitchat. Joe Biden hosted PM Modi at the White House on September 24 for their first in-person meeting. The Prime Minister is seen embracing President Macron and engaged in an animated discussion with Justin Trudeau and Boris Johnson.
Earlier, all the world leaders participating in the G20 Summit, including PM Modi, gathered for a "family photo".
The prime minister will be participating in the G20 Summit in Rome from October 30-31 at the invitation of Italian Prime Minister Mario Draghi.
